Kuala lumpur: Professional women's singles shuttler Goh Jin Wei has been considered for Malaysia's Uber Cup squad to strengthen the team's depth and competitiveness. National singles coaching director Kenneth Jonassen highlighted Jin Wei's recent performance, particularly her strong fighting display at the Thailand Masters where she finished runner-up, as evidence of her return to a high level. According to BERNAMA News Agency, Jonassen emphasized that Jin Wei's inclusion is also based on her experience in previous team competitions, including her participation in last year's Sudirman Cup. Jonassen expressed his desire to have a balanced team with three women's singles players at almost the same level, which he noted is unique. He believes this would make the team very competitive, potentially against all but the very top teams. Jonassen also mentioned that Jin Wei, currently ranked as Malaysia's third women's singles player, could play an essential role in strengthening the team's lineup. As a third single s player, she could provide more depth to the team due to her experience in several team events. However, Jonassen stated that the final decision on Jin Wei's participation rests with the player herself. Additionally, Jin Wei, along with professional shuttlers Lee Zii Jia and his coach, Liew Darren, held an hour-long meeting with Chong Wei regarding their participation in the Thomas Cup and Uber Cup Finals from April 24 to May 3.
